The primary function of a rain cap is keeping precipitation out of the open flue in North Olmsted, OH. Without a cap, rain falls directly into the open flue with every rain event, saturating the liner, accumulating on the smoke shelf, and in sufficient volume entering the firebox directly in North Olmsted. Consistent direct precipitation exposure accelerates liner deterioration and mortar joint erosion inside the flue faster than any other single factor in North Olmsted, OH. A correctly installed rain cap eliminates direct precipitation entry into the flue entirely in North Olmsted.
A rain cap with mesh sides physically prevents wildlife from entering the flue in North Olmsted. Birds, squirrels, raccoons, and bats can all enter an uncapped chimney flue. Each species brings complications including nesting material fire hazards, waste contamination, and in the case of chimney swifts, federal protected species protocols that prevent nest disturbance during nesting season in North Olmsted, OH. A correctly installed cap with intact mesh sides makes wildlife entry impossible regardless of how persistent the animal is in North Olmsted. It is the only permanent prevention available. Everything else is temporary deterrence in North Olmsted, OH.
The mesh sides of a rain cap contain sparks and embers that might otherwise exit the flue and land on the roof or adjacent combustibles during wood-burning fireplace use in North Olmsted, OH. Embers that exit an uncapped flue can land on wood shingles, adjacent structures, or dry debris on the roof surface in North Olmsted. A cap with correctly specified mesh size contains sparks without restricting normal chimney airflow in North Olmsted, OH.
Leaves, twigs, seed pods, and windblown debris accumulate in uncapped chimneys particularly during fall and in areas with significant tree canopy in North Olmsted. Accumulated debris in the flue is both a draft obstruction and a fire hazard. Dry leaves and twigs in the flue path during fireplace use are combustible materials in direct contact with hot exhaust in North Olmsted, OH. A rain cap with mesh sides prevents debris accumulation entirely in North Olmsted.

A cap whose cover area does not adequately overhang the flue opening allows rain to enter at the cap edges in driven rain conditions in North Olmsted, OH. Wind-driven rain that hits the cap at an angle can be deflected under the cap edge and into the flue if the overhang is not sufficient to direct it away in North Olmsted. A cap that is undersized in its mesh area allows animals to push under the cap edges because the cap is not large enough to create adequate contact with the liner or chimney top mounting surface in North Olmsted, OH. An undersized cap provides the appearance of protection while allowing the specific things it was installed to prevent in North Olmsted.
A cap significantly larger than the flue it covers creates airflow turbulence at the flue exit that can impair draft performance in North Olmsted. It may also not mount securely to the liner or chimney top because the cap's mounting collar does not correctly engage the liner or chimney top surface in North Olmsted, OH. A loose cap that is rattling in wind is a mounting failure that creates noise, accelerates cap wear, and eventually produces a cap that is not correctly positioned over the flue in North Olmsted.

For a single-flue cap, correct sizing is based on the interior flue liner dimensions in North Olmsted. The cap's cover must adequately overhang the liner by at least 2 inches on all sides to ensure rain driven from any direction is deflected away from the liner opening in North Olmsted, OH. The mounting collar must engage the liner or chimney top surface correctly to create a weathertight connection in North Olmsted. For multi-flue and full-width caps, correct sizing is based on the full chimney top dimensions including all flue openings and the surrounding masonry area in North Olmsted, OH.

This section matters if you are calling about a chimney leak and wondering if a rain cap is the complete solution in North Olmsted.
Failed chimney flashing at the chimney-roof junction allows water entry at the sides of the chimney regardless of whether the flue is capped in North Olmsted. Flashing failure and the absence of a rain cap are different leak sources that require different repairs in North Olmsted, OH. Installing a cap addresses the flue entry component. It does not address failed flashing in North Olmsted.
A cracked chimney crown allows water direct entry into the space between the outer masonry and the liner in North Olmsted. This entry point is separate from the open flue that a rain cap covers. A rain cap installed over a cracked crown still has a cracked crown that is allowing water in alongside the cap's protection in North Olmsted, OH. Both repairs are needed in North Olmsted.
